Fish oil has sometimes caused me to have an upset stomach. What can I do to avoid that?

OfflineLower quality products that have not been purified and distilled can often cause an upset stomach, as well as capsules that have spoiled. If you see cloudy deposits in the oil inside your capsules, that can mean that they are rancid and should not be taken. By enteric-coating our capsules we deliver oils directly to the intestines for better absorption and no fishy aftertaste or 'repeat'. We have also added plant lipase (a natural fat-splitting enzyme) that helps the body digest and absorb the beneficial oils.
